Fixed crash bug in DCS games.
Updated the fcompress APIs to allow for specifying a compression level. Removed the concept of state saving tags, which was a hack to get save states to work with multiple CPU cores. Simplified the state saving system as a result, performing the operation in a single pass and without allocating a full blob of memory. Also enabled minimal compression.
